What does a medical executive assistant do at a hospital?

A medical executive assistant at a hospital provides administrative support to senior healthcare leaders, managing schedules, coordinating meetings, preparing reports, and handling correspondence. They often use electronic health records and office software, requiring strong organizational and communication skills to ensure smooth operations within the healthcare environment.

What is a medical executive assistant?

Medical Executive Assistants are specialized administrative professionals who support executives and senior leaders within healthcare organizations. Their responsibilities typically include managing schedules, preparing reports, coordinating meetings, handling confidential information, and liaising between medical staff and upper management. They may also assist with project management, regulatory compliance, and communication with patients or external partners. Medical Executive Assistants play a crucial role in ensuring smooth operations and organizational efficiency in healthcare settings.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a medical executive assistant?

To thrive as a Medical Executive Assistant, you need exceptional organizational skills, knowledge of medical terminology, and experience with administrative support, often supported by an associate's degree or specialized certification. Familiarity with electronic health records (EHR) systems, scheduling software, and office productivity tools is typically required. Outstanding communication, discretion, and multitasking abilities set top performers apart in managing sensitive information and demanding schedules. These competencies ensure efficient executive support, smooth office operations, and the safeguarding of confidential medical data.

How does a medical executive assistant typically collaborate with healthcare professionals and administrative teams?

Medical Executive Assistants play a vital role in bridging communication between executives, healthcare providers, and administrative staff. They often coordinate meetings, manage confidential correspondence, and facilitate the smooth flow of information across departments. This requires strong interpersonal skills, discretion, and the ability to prioritize tasks in a fast-paced environment. Collaborating closely with medical staff and administration ensures that the executive's schedule aligns with clinical priorities and organizational goals.

Job Summary and Qualifications

Job Summary:

Under direction of the Executive Assistant to the CEO, provides administration support to Senior Leadership, coordinates communication between department directors and staff.

What you will do in the role:

  • Types correspondence and other materials on a variety of general and technical topics, some of which are of a highly confidential nature.
  • Ensure smooth operation of the Administrative offices.
  • Coordinates all Administrative files; assists in the coordination and maintenance of all records to assure compliance with all JCAHO and other regulatory requirements and standards.
  • Ensures renewal for all hospital licenses and permits.
  • Attends meetings and prepares minutes as needed. Maintains calendars and makes calendar appointments for all executives in Administration.
  • Maintains database for Hospital contracts. Create and maintain physician contracts in upside.
  • Schedules hospital-wide meetings and classes; Prepares and distributes monthly master calendar.
  • Maintains status as Notary Public.
  • Assists Executive Assistant with projects as needed.
  • Assist with typing for all Administrative policies and procedures.
  • Answers telephone and screens visitors and responds to their questions exercising discretion and judgment or relays information to appropriate person.
  • Requisitions needed office supplies.
What qualifications you will need:
  • Associate's Degree is preferred
  • 3 years experience required
